Samaroo Surname Meaning
User-submitted Reference
The surname Samaroo is derived from the Bhojpuri word shomaar, meaning 'Monday'. When the East Indian indentured laborers came to Trinidad in the 1800s, they had a tradition of naming children based on the time, day, month and horoscopes of the child. However, to do this a pundit (priest) was needed, which there were not many of in the country. Therefore, many Indians named their children based on the actual name of the day of the week on which the child was born. Hence, those born on shomaar (Monday) were either Shomaaroo, later Samaroo (boy) or Shomaria (girl). Due to the tradition of taking the father's first name as their last name, the name Samaroo then became a common surname throughout the country. As more modern Hindi and Western names began to be used over time in Trinidad, Samaroo has remained exclusively a surname.

How Common Is The Last Name Samaroo? popularity and diffusion
This last name is the 56,805th most widespread last name at a global level It is held by around 1 in 816,806 people. The surname Samaroo occurs predominantly in The Americas, where 98 percent of Samaroo live; 49 percent live in Caribbean and 49 percent live in Anglo-Caribbean. Samaroo is also the 45,304th most commonly held first name internationally, borne by 15,523 people.
It is most frequent in Trinidad and Tobago, where it is carried by 4,315 people, or 1 in 316. In Trinidad and Tobago it is primarily found in: Couva-Tabaquite-Talparo Regional Corporation, where 20 percent live, Penal-Debe Regional Corporation, where 15 percent live and Tunapuna-Piarco Regional Corporation, where 15 percent live. Not including Trinidad and Tobago Samaroo occurs in 27 countries. It also occurs in Guyana, where 22 percent live and The United States, where 20 percent live.
